What is the Transfer Code UBA?

The transfer code UBA is a unique short code that allows customers of United Bank for Africa (UBA) to perform various banking transactions using their mobile phones. With this service, you can easily send money to friends and family, pay bills, and check your account balance without the need for internet access. This feature is particularly beneficial for individuals in remote areas or those who prefer the simplicity of mobile banking.

How Do You Activate the Transfer Code UBA?

Activating the transfer code UBA is a straightforward process. Here’s how you can do it:

  1. Dial *919# on your mobile phone.
  2. Follow the prompts to set up your account.
  3. Choose the services you wish to activate.
  4. Receive a confirmation message once your activation is successful.

It is important to note that you must have a registered UBA account to use this service.

What Transactions Can You Perform with the Transfer Code UBA?

The transfer code UBA allows you to perform a variety of transactions, including but not limited to:

  • Sending money to other UBA accounts or different banks.
  • Checking your account balance.
  • Paying bills such as utilities, cable, and internet.
  • Buying airtime for your mobile phone.

This versatility makes the transfer code UBA an invaluable tool for managing your financial transactions on the go.

Who Can Use the Transfer Code UBA?

Any UBA customer with a registered account can utilize the transfer code UBA. This includes individual account holders, businesses, and corporate entities. However, users must ensure their mobile numbers are linked to their bank accounts to enable the service.

How to Troubleshoot Common Issues with the Transfer Code UBA?

Despite its simplicity, users may occasionally encounter issues while using the transfer code UBA. Here are some common problems and solutions:

  • Transaction Failure: Ensure you have sufficient funds in your account and verify the recipient's details.
  • Unresponsive Code: Check your network connection; if the issue persists, contact UBA customer service for assistance.
  • Forgotten PIN: Follow the prompts to reset your PIN securely.
